Digital Marketing Specialist-Information Technology Services-DM 187
Information Technology Services Located in Cairo, Egypt Looking for a Digital Marketing Specialist with the below Requirements : 3+ years of …
Read MoreEducation Company Located in Cairo,Egypt is seeking Digital Marketing Executive with the below requirements:
Responsibilities :